Jinkx Monsoon Is Making Her Carnegie Hall Debut in 2025: ‘I’m Thrilled and Humbled and Ready’

Written by on February 7, 2024

There’s no need to “convince yourself” of any “delusion” — drag superstar Jinkx Monsoon is really performing at Carnegie Hall!

On Wednesday (Feb. 7), Carnegie Hall officially announced their 2024-25 concert season. Among the many new shows coming to the legendary New York City venue, one in particular stood out to Drag Race; on Valentine’s Day 2025, the concert hall revealed that Monsoon would be taking to the stage.

While the performer has yet to reveal the title or poster for their show, Monsoon teased in a press release that the one-night-only concert would feature original songs and covers spanning genres like cabaret, show tunes, rock and pop, as well as a few unannounced special guests.

“I truly don’t know what to say — my whole life, I’ve listened to my idols’ voices as they sung on the stage of Carnegie Hall … and now I get to join them in the pantheon?” she said in a statement. “All I know is, I’m thrilled and humbled and READY!”

This won’t be the queen’s first time on an iconic New York stage — in January 2023, Monsoon made her Broadway debut in Chicago, where she played the Cook County Jail’s mother hen Matron “Mama” Morton for a 10-week engagement. Following her run on the Great White Way, the triple-threat performed their character’s signature song, “When You’re Good to Mama,” on the finale episode of RuPaul’s Drag Race season 15.
